Tender Overview

The Directorate Of Social Justice And Empowerment invites bids for comprehensive Event Management Services at a national level. The scope includes theme-based events, participation arrangements, venue development, complete execution, coordination and staffing, as well as marketing and promotion. The estimated value is ₹6,000,000, signaling a sizable, multi-faceted engagement across a national footprint. This tender emphasizes end-to-end project delivery, high coordination needs, and robust promotional activities in support of social justice and empowerment initiatives. Unique aspects include a broad activity spectrum and the requirement for cohesive execution across multiple event components within a single contract.
